Bedtime at the Shelter
EDITORS COMMENTS
is a poignant oil painting by Danish artist Jens Birkholm, created in the early 20th century in 1901. This evocative work of art depicts a group of men huddled together in a dimly lit shelter, engaged in their nightly bedtime routine. The painting, held in the esteemed collections of the National Gallery of Denmark (SMK), offers a glimpse into the lives of the less fortunate in Danish society during this era. The men, all clad in their bare essentials, stand or sit in various poses, some leaning against the rough, wooden walls, while others lie down on makeshift beds. The use of color is sparse and muted, with the predominantly earthy tones adding to the somber atmosphere. The interior of the shelter, with its worn-out furniture and peeling walls, speaks volumes about the harsh realities of poverty and the struggle for survival. Birkholm masterfully captures the essence of routine and community in this powerful group portrait. The men, though facing hardships, are not alone. They share the burden of their circumstances, creating a sense of camaraderie and resilience. The painting is a poignant reminder of the human spirit's ability to endure even the most challenging conditions. "Bedtime at the Shelter" is a significant work in Danish art history, showcasing the raw and unfiltered realities of life in the early 1900s. It invites viewers to reflect on the concept of heritage and the importance of preserving and understanding the past. This evocative painting continues to resonate with audiences today, offering a poignant commentary on the human condition and the power of community in times of adversity.
